The ecological effects and valorization of coal fines-a review
Lesley Chioneso Mutyavaviri1, Chido Hermes Chihobo2, Denzel Christopher Makepa2
1Department of Environmental Science and Technology, Chinhoyi University of Technology, 72 Harare-Chirundu Road, Chinhoyi, Zimbabwe. lesleycmutyavaviri@gmail.com.
Abstract:
The beneficiation and valorization of coal fines is an important element that has to be considered in coal waste management. This review aims to assess the potential ecological impacts that arise due to coal fines dumping and the various methods that can be used for value addition and beneficiation of the coal fines for domestic and industrial use. The PRISMA method was used for the identification and inclusion of studies in the review and studies which focused on coal fines production, utilization, and their effects on the environment which were included in the review. The review showed that several technologies such as briquetting, pelletization, coal-water slurry, brickmaking, and fluidized bed technology have been developed in an effort to reduce the quantities of coal fines in the environment as they are an ecological threat through air, water, and soil pollution. These methods have the potential to be scaled up to the industrial level as there are vast quantities of coal fines to support the industry.
